A great lawn is built through consistent care across the seasons - not just a weekly mow. Our lawn care program covers all the essentials: regular mowing at the correct height, seasonal feeding, aeration to relieve compaction, scarification to remove thatch, and moss control for Irish lawns that struggle with damp, shady conditions. We tailor the program to your lawn's specific needs, and you'll see the difference within a single season.
Regular mowing
Mowing at the right height for the season, with edging and grass collection.
Lawn aeration
Core aeration to relieve soil compaction, improve drainage and encourage deep rooting.
Scarification & thatch removal
Mechanical removal of moss and thatch to let air, water and nutrients reach the soil.
Seasonal fertilisation
Spring/summer feed for growth, autumn feed for root strength - organic options available.

Frequently asked
- What does a seasonal lawn care program include?
- Typically mowing, feeding, scarifying, aeration and weed control, scheduled around the growing season.
- How often should a lawn be treated?
- Most lawns benefit from treatments every 6-8 weeks during the growing season.
- Can you help revive a patchy or mossy lawn?
- Yes, scarifying and overseeding as part of a program can restore even a neglected lawn over a season or two.
